GM is tight with their release on pics...Look how long it took to get new Corvette pics. You sure didn't see them 2 years before production. I think the camaro will be back. There is a steel press meeting that shows what companies have planned for the upcoming years and it shows a camaro on the zeta platform planned for 2007. Still no guarantees of course but i think it will be back.
